## Alert: StatRelay Sidecar Flush Lag

This alert fires when the StatRelay metrics-aggregation sidecar falls more than 120 seconds behind on flushing buffered samples to the Coalmine backend. Plugin-emitted counters are buffered in-process, so sustained lag usually means a plugin is emitting unbounded label cardinality or blocking the flush thread. Check your plugin's metric registration against the published cardinality limits before escalating. If the lag persists after your plugin is ruled out, contact the telemetry team.

escalation mailbox, bagug-fahof: novdor.wendor.jormir@norvalabs.example

## Releases

Crashloft is the crash-report ingestion pipeline for the Pebblewalk mobile app. Releases are cut weekly from the `stable` branch and pushed to the ingest fleet via the Dunmore deploy tool. If a release fails mid-rollout, the previous build stays active; just re-run the deploy with the prior tag. All artifacts must be signed before Dunmore will accept them. The deploy key used by the pipeline is:

rollout seal: bky9_aBG1gvAyU

Ticket: BRV-2241 — Expired snapshot-service credentials

The Lumenkit snapshot tests started failing overnight: every UI component diff returns an auth error from the Frostpane comparison service. Root cause is the expired service credential, not actual visual regressions. New team members: do not approve or regenerate baselines until this clears. A fresh credential has been issued for the staging tier. Set your environment to the key below.

gateway credential: kto3_qfe

# Welcome to the Glimmerboard admin dashboard setup.
# Quick context for new folks: dark mode here isn't just CSS —
# theme preferences are stored server-side per admin, so the
# client below has to fetch the theme payload from our internal
# Duskwell service before first render. Otherwise you get the
# dreaded white flash everyone complains about in standup.
# The client caches the theme for an hour; clear it if you're
# testing palette changes. To initialize the client, you'll
# need the Duskwell service key, which goes right below.

API key for fadug-fafof: kto7_7rjklQM